Air filter cartridges are disclosed. Also described are air cleaners including the filter cartridges. Methods of assembly and use are also provided. Also, systems of use are described.

What is claimed is: 1. An air filter cartridge comprising: (a) a filter media pack comprising filter media and having a first flow face and a second, opposite, flow face; the filter media pack having a rectangular cross-sectional shape in a direction perpendicular to the central flow axis; and (ii) the filter media pack comprising four sides, including a first pair of first and second opposite sides and a second pair of first and second opposite sides, extending between the first flow face and the second flow face; (b) first and second side pieces positioned, respectively, on the first pair of first and second opposite sides of the filter media pack, wherein: (i) the first and second side pieces are molded in place; and (ii) the first and second side pieces each comprise a first abutment surface and a second abutment surface, wherein: (A) the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face of the first and second side pieces are located beyond one of the first flow face and the second flow face of the filter media pack and in a direction away from the filter media pack; (B) the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face of the first and second side pieces each extend a length and are constructed to engage an air cleaner housing, in use, to support the filter cartridge when the filter cartridge is installed in the air cleaner housing; and (C) the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face of the first side piece are spaced from each other, and the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face of the second side piece are spaced from each other; and (c) a housing seal arrangement for sealing the air filter cartridge to an air cleaner housing, in use, wherein: (i) the seal member includes a seal surface that forms an axially directed seal, in use; and (ii) the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face of the first and second side pieces are non-parallel to the seal surface of the seal member. 2.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) the filter media pack comprises alternating fluted media and facing media. 3. An air filter cartridge according to claim 2 wherein: (a) the alternating fluted media and facing media are secured to each other at one end of the first flow face and the second flow faces. 4. An air filter cartridge according to claim 2 wherein: (a) the alternating fluted media and facing media comprises a stack of alternating strips of a fluted media sheet secured to a facing media sheet. 5.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) the housing seal arrangement further comprises a receiving trough positioned inwardly from the seal surface that forms an axially directed seal, in use. 6.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) the first and second side pieces each comprise a non-abutment surface separating each of the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face, wherein the non-abutment surface is constructed to not engage an air cleaner housing, in use. 7.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) the seal member extends across the first pair of first and second sides of the filter media pack and across the second pair of the first and second sides of the filter media pack. 8. An air filter cartridge according to claim 7 wherein: (a) the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face extend at an angle of at least 2 degrees to the seal surface of the seal member at a location along the seal member extending across the first and second side pieces. 9. An air filter cartridge according to claim 7 wherein: (a) the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face extend at an angle of at least 2 degrees to 45 degrees to the seal surface of the seal member at a location along the seal member extending across the first and second side pieces. 10.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) a portion of the seal surface of the seal member extends parallel to the filter media pack first flow face. 11.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) a portion of the seal surface of the seal member extends at an angle of at least 2 degrees to a plane perpendicular to the central flow axis. 12.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face of the first and second side pieces are located beyond the first flow face in a direction away from the filter media pack. 13.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) the first abutment surface and the second abutment surface of the first and second side pieces are located beyond the second flow face in a direction away from the filter media pack. 14.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 further comprising: (a) a protective material located over the second pair of first and second sides of the filter media pack. 15. An air filter cartridge according to claim 14 wherein: (a) the protective material is secured in place against the filter media pack by molding the first and second side pieces to the first pair of opposite sides of the filter media pack. 16. An air filter cartridge according to claim 14 wherein: (a) the protective material comprises cardboard or plastic. 17.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) at least 30% of the second pair of first and second opposite sides of the filter media pack is uncovered. 18.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) at least 40% of the second pair of first and second opposite sides of the filter media pack is uncovered. 19.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) the first and second side pieces have an as-molded density of no greater than about 30 lbs./ft. 3 . 20. An air filter cartridge according to claim 1 wherein: (a) the first and second side pieces have a hardness, Shore A, of no greater than about 30.
